It is complaining because there are no services associated with the  
host.  Host dependencies work for hosts while service dependancies  
work only with services.  http://nagios.sourceforge.net/docs/3_0/dependencies.html

The reason for setting up hosts with check-host-alive (ping) as well  
as a PING service is because Nagios treats host and services  
differently.  I would recommend checking out the doc "host checks" and  
"service checks" which explain the difference between them.

A solution, even if you did not like the redundant ping checks, would  
be to have the host checked with check-host-alive but not include a  
check interval for the host.  Then setup a ping service for that host  
with a check interval that you would like it checked at.  The host  
check check-host-alive would be run at startup or when the service has  
a problem.

> I'm trying to implement hostgroup dependency on the router status .
> I am able to do the host/hostgroup dependency , but  I am uncertain  
> how to make sure that if a
> router is in the "danger" status , i want to disable the service  
> notifications for all the hosts in
> the host group.
>
> I am not having any service run on the router - just the default  
> check-host-alive , but when i try
> to do  dependency on that service , nagios complains on that no  
> services are assigned to the
> host "router" .
>
> anyone got an idea how to get such a set up to work ?
>
> adding a ping test to the router is redundant and there for not an  
> option we want to implement .
